The Child Figure in English Literature Robert Pattison
The Child Figure in English Literature
Robert Pattison
In a skillful fusion of theology, social history, and literature, Pattison isolates and analyzes the repeated conjunction of the literary figure of the child with two fundamental ideas of Western culture: the fall of man and the concept of Original Sin.
